BABY SOCKS AND RELATED ITEMS WITH IMPROVED IN-PLACE RETENTION
An improved baby sock that will reduce the instance of the sock coming off the foot while in use and related applications to children's, women's, and men's socks. Application of the invention to improved in-place retention for hats, mittens, foot-less onesies, shoes, and bedding are presented.
PERSONAL PROTECTIVE EQUIPMENT
Personal protective equipment configured to reduce the discomfort of the protruding joint of the conventional personal protective equipment includes a sleeve, at least one adhesive membrane, and at least one thin film. The sleeve is formed by curving an elastic fabric and joining two opposite joining edges of the elastic fabric in a butting manner. The adhesive membrane has an adhesive side adhesively attached to a surface of the sleeve over an area where the two opposite joining edges of the sleeve extend. The thin film covers and is adhesively attached to another adhesive side of the adhesive membrane. The personal protective equipment, therefore, has a flat joint and is spared those prior art drawbacks attributable to the protuberance of a hemmed border or overlap seam, such as an uncomfortable sensation and a lack of conformity to the contour of the body part being protected.
MEDICAL GLOVE ANTI-SLIP AND FLUID GUARD BAND
An elastic band for attachment over the juncture of a surgical glove and sleeve of a surgical gown is disclosed. The elastic band has an abrasive inner surface in contact with the juncture to limit movement of the band relative to the juncture. A circumferential portion of the inner surface is concave. The band may be of variable circumferences to fit the user, adjusting to the size of the user's wrist.
WAISTBAND WITH SUPPORT PANEL
Aspects herein relate to a waistband construct designed to provide support to a torso area of a wearer and more specifically, a mid to lower torso area of a human wearer, (i.e. a pelvic area of a wearer). The waistband construct in accordance herein may have a multiple modulus of elasticity construction with at least one variation in modulus of elasticity along a circumference of the waistband construct. For example, the waistband construct in accordance with aspects herein may have a first portion having a first modulus of elasticity and a second portion having a second modulus of elasticity, where at least the portion having the higher modulus of elasticity may have a multiple layer construction for providing an effective support mechanism to at least a portion of the mid to lower torso area of the wearer.
GARMENT FOR USE WITH STOMAS
Disclosed herein are form-fitting garments configured to hold an ostomy pouch close to the body via a shaped interior pocket creating a barrier between the pouch and skin of an individual. The garment may include a plurality of pockets such that an unused pocket may serve to hold additional supplies. The garment is preferably configured to have a maximum stretch in the horizontal direction allowing for the expansion of the pouch while having minimal stretching in the vertical direction to prevent the interior pocket and garment from sagging under the weight of the pouch.
Grip augmentation straps
A slap wrap style grip augmentation strap is provided in which the extended securing strap is lined with a bistable ribbon formed of metal or similarly functioning material. The lined strap extends from a wrist loop and provide a self-wrapping ability which allows the user to get a tighter and more uniform grip that was previously much harder or near impossible to obtain with other lifting straps. Gripping efficiency is improved with quickly applied, strong and equal equally applied attachment to a targeted piece of exercise equipment. The use of a strap of the present invention will encourage proper body mechanics during lifting exercises that would help prevent these potential dangers. Garment Fastening Systems, Devices and Methods
New garment-fastening techniques are provided. In some embodiments, a new form of adjustable hair tie is provided. In some such embodiments, a new form of scrunchie is provided. In some embodiments, the new form of scrunchie includes widely-variable, user-adjustable tension, elastic cushioning disposed on or about a contact area with a user's hair, and a smooth (e.g., silk) surface. In some embodiments, the contact area surrounds and defines a central hair-gripping void with a user-variable size, and includes a substantially flattened support and profile. In some embodiments, a new form of waistband, wristband, or other clothing-fastening band of material is provided. In some such embodiments, a new form of garment enhancement device, incorporating a unique pattern of alignment- and grip-enhancing sub-elements, is provided on or about such a band, which improves garment positioning, and provides a non-stick hold on a user's body.
Activewear Garment
An activewear garment having facial opening formed on an anterior side of an upper head portion of the garment. An elastic securing band is attached to an interior rim of the facial opening, said elastic securing band being attached around the entire circumference of said facial opening. An adhering layer composed of one or more types of adhesive substances, including pressure sensitive adhesives, are applied to an interior side of the elastic securing band, such adhering layer being configured to releasably adhere to a user's facial skin, thereby preventing the full or partial dislodgement of such activewear garment during high contact athletic activities.

Garment
A garment (10) comprising a grip coating located on inner and outer surfaces of a garment section (12) so as to generate in use friction between a wearer's skin and the garment (10) and friction between the garment (10) and an external contact surface. The grip coating includes a first array of grip elements (14) located on the inner surface of the garment section (12) and a second array of grip elements (16) located on the outer surface of the garment section (12). The first and second arrays are arranged relative to each other so that the grip elements (14,16) of the first and second arrays are offset relative to each other and do not overlie or overlap each other.
